Description
CART (62-76) (HUMAN, RAT) is a neuropeptide derived from the CART (Cocaineand Amphetamine-Regulated Transcript) protein, which is found in both humans and rats. It functions as a neurotransmitter and is involved in the regulation of appetite and energy balance. CART (62-76) has anorexigenic effects, meaning it suppresses appetite and reduces food intake. Additionally, it plays a role in the regulation of stress and anxiety, as well as in the modulation of the reward pathway in the brain.
Uses
Used in Pharmaceutical Industry:
CART (62-76) (HUMAN, RAT) is used as a potential therapeutic agent for the treatment of obesity and eating disorders. Its anorexigenic effects make it a promising candidate for managing appetite and food intake, which can help in weight loss and maintaining a healthy body weight.
Used in Neuroscience Research:
CART (62-76) (HUMAN, RAT) is used as a research tool in neuroscience to study the mechanisms underlying appetite regulation, stress and anxiety, and the reward pathway in the brain. Understanding the role of CART (62-76) in these processes can provide insights into the development of new treatments for various neurological and psychiatric disorders.
